Mr Gary Ross is a leading plastic surgeon in the North West of England and offers an individualised range of plastic and cosmetic surgery treatments to enhance appearance.
He is a member of BAAPS and BAPRAS and is a fully accredited plastic surgeon on the General Medical Council's specialist register for plastic surgery. He provides a personalized service aimed at delivering the highest quality of care to patients.
Mr Ross runs a cosmetic practice in breast and facial surgery that complements his NHS reconstructive practice in these areas.
Mr Ross qualified in medicine at the University of Bristol, he underwent a basic surgical training in Australia, Bristol and Plymouth before beginning a career in plastic surgery in 1997. Following experience in the plastic surgery units of Plymouth and Bristol he spent 2 years in the Canniesburn Plastic Surgery Unit, Glasgow as a head and neck fellow completing a higher doctorate (MD) in head and neck surgery.
Following this he completed his speciality plastic surgery training programme in the North West leading to a further qualification from the Royal College of Surgeons of Edinburgh (FRCS plast) and subsequently the Certificate of Completiong of Training (CCT). His fellowships have included the mentor international aesthetic surgery fellowship (King Edward VII Hospital, Harley Street, London), the North West Aesthetic Fellowship (Chester, Loverpool, Manchester) and a 1 year North American plastic surgery fellowship in Toronto (Canada) in head, neck and breast surgery.
Mr Ross has published extensively both nationally and internationally comprising over 50 peer reviewed articles and a number of book chapters (including face lifts, brow lifts, blepharoplasty).
He has presented worldwide as a key note lecturer and moderator and has organised a number of international conferences and instructional courses.
He is actively involved in teaching both undergraduate Medical Students and postgraduate Plastic Surgical Trainees through his role as honorary senior clinical lecturer. He has received widespread recognition for his charitable work including the provision of plastic surgery expertise following the Pakistan Earthquake through the Mobile International Surgical Teams charity.
